WebDec 26, 2024 · How To Cook Meatballs With Grape Jelly And Bbq Sauce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). In a large bowl, mix together the ground beef, BBQ sauce, grape jelly, garlic, salt and pepper. Form the meat mixture into meatballs and place them on a greased baking sheet. Bake for 15-20 minutes or until the meatballs are cooked through.

WebJun 1, 2024 · Oven: Turn the oven to 350 degrees and place the grape jelly meatballs in a casserole dish and cover with aluminum foil. Heat for 15-20 minutes or until they reach the desired temperature. Stovetop: Add them to a saucepan and warm using low-medium heat. Stir frequently until they are hot.
